Anthony E. Wilson, MD, was raised in rural central Massachusetts in a close Seventh-Day Adventist religious family.  Anthony chose to pursue a career in medicine. He graduated from the University of Massachusetts Chan Medical School in 1990 and completed his Residency at the University of Massachusetts Medical Center in 1993. After specializing in Primary Care and Hospital Medicine for over two decades, he completed his Fellowship in Hospice and Palliative Care Medicine at the Northshore and Long Island Jewish Medical Center in 2015. His practice focused on inpatient Palliative Care at Milford Regional Medical Center until 2022.

While in medical school, he met his husband, Jay Sorgman, MD. Soon after, they married.  They were together for 32 years until Jay died of Glioblastoma at the age of 58. Anthony has since retired from practicing medicine and has passionately shared what he has learned through writing about grief. He finds peace in spirituality, personal growth, positive psychology, and meditation. He loves hiking, traveling, personal growth retreats, piano playing, and activities with his mom, siblings, in-laws, and extended family.
